Bergkamp is known for being silent. Sure he will have influence on individuals (just like Stam has for defenders), but their value for Ajax has been nothing compared to Frank de Boer.
I'd like to describe De Boer as very authentic in huge contrast with all the crazy behaving actors out there. No nonsense, honest, modest, calm and realistic in interviews but very driven and demanding (a true winner) and very normal. There are stories from people who were surprised by seeing him helping his wife out with her (furniture) store in his rare spare time. It must be a funny surpise to see Frank de Boer delivering some stuff at your house.
Although most non Ajax supporters hate Ajax (jealousy i guess), almost no-one dislikes De Boer. Despite or maybe because his indepedent acting. Never saying crazy things in the press, never playing a role. Wearing his frown if not satisfied but not complaining, and despite his sloppy word choice contentwise alway saying the right thing (socially intelligent).
In a very difficult time at Ajax (if you know the club, you know how difficult it can be working there), with the whole club fighting and a lot of negative press, he managed to keep his team out of it all, kept calm and won 4 titles in a row. While many people thought PSV had the better team. Every year building a new team, without complaint and making it work with not the best material (because Ajax did not want to spend big money anymore). That's a big achievement.
Negative point is that many Ajax fans thought the team played too boring (and i agree). But Ajax is known for the very critical and spoiled fans: winning is not enough.
